Description

Punch, or the London Charivari, Volume 153, July 25, 1917, is a humorous and satirical compilation that reflects the mood of Britain during World War I. Published by a variety of authors and writers associated with the iconic magazine Punch, this volume showcases an intriguing blend of wit, parody, and social commentary, characteristic of the publication. Filled with amusing illustrations, poignant commentary, and clever verse, this edition captures the complexities of life under wartime conditions. The contributors utilize humor as a tool to provide commentary on societal norms, politics, and the absurdities of the era. Readers will find an array of topics, from the struggles of everyday citizens to the quirks of military life, all rendered with a distinctive and light-hearted tone. Overall, this volume serves as both a historical document and a source of entertainment, encapsulating the British spirit of resilience and humor during one of its most challenging times.
